Bibio - Ambivalence Avenue


Sounds like Prefuse 73 with a strong folk flavor. Hip-hop with melody and soul. Badly Drawn Boy finds Pro Tools. Most of the songs feel like their made up of found sounds, or a guy in his underwear sitting around in his sparsely furnished flat upstairs with a computer and a guitar. My favorite is Lovers' Carvings, which relegates the computer to merely a beat machine in the background, while Bibio's voice and guitar take center stage. Unfortunately, the intro to the song is about 90 seconds long and not as good, so fast forward past it to get to the good part.



Standout tracks: Ambivalence Avenue, Fire Ant, Lovers' Carvings, S'Vive, Dwrcan
